Jurgen Klopp coy on Mo Salah involvement as Liverpool “must watch out” – Liverpool FC

Mohamed Salah returned to coaching on Wednesday and is a part of Liverpool’s travelling squad to Prague, however Jurgen Klopp remained coy on his degree of involvement on Thursday.

The Egyptian missed the final 4 matches after a setback on return from a hamstring damage, however his return to the squad alerts the top of one other watch for his comeback.

With Man Metropolis’s go to solely days away, Salah has timed his return completely, and Klopp provided a quick replace on his No. 11 after his inclusion for Thursday’s Europa League tie.

“He’s with us, skilled for 2 days so stuffed with vitality, we have now to see,” Klopp mentioned of the 31-year-old. “It’s so good that he’s again, actually good for us. You may see on his face, he’s very joyful.

“Impossible scenario with being that lengthy out, in for a second at Brentford – performed an extremely recreation there – and out once more.

“We wish to watch out, we have now to watch out, however we’re in the midst of a brilliant intense interval of the season and we’d like everyone.

“Let’s see how lengthy we will use him, that’s how it’s with him and others as properly. Simply excellent news.”

Salah’s comeback comes at a time when Egypt insist he will probably be known as up for his or her worldwide pleasant later this month if he performs any minutes for Liverpool, regardless of the membership asking for him to be exempt.

Klopp insisted the choice is out of his fingers, however there’s a clear need for Salah to be accurately managed after a uncommon spell on the sidelines.

“That will probably be determined in a distinct division, let’s see how lengthy he can play now,” Klopp mentioned of Salah’s upcoming involvement with Egypt.

“Solely two days in staff coaching, in a distinct scenario, gamers are usually not within the squad on this second.

“In our scenario it is sensible, what can we give him and the way a lot we will use him. We are going to see.

“Two video games with Egypt, it isn’t as much as me, we’re not actually concerned. That is mentioned in different departments.”

The Reds face Sparta Prague on the earlier time of 5.45pm (UK) on Thursday night, and we will at the very least anticipate to see Salah come off the bench earlier than Liverpool flip their consideration to Man Metropolis on Sunday.
